Our client is a growing corrugated packaging manufacturer located in Windsor, Ontario. The organization provides high-quality packaging solutions and continues to invest in skilled production talent to support ongoing growth and customer demand.
Position Overview
We are currently seeking an experienced Lead Die Cutter Operator to join the production team. This role is ideal for someone with hands-on die cutting experience in a corrugated packaging environment, particularly with equipment such as RDC die cutters, McKinley, Ward, or similar rotary die cutting machinery with 2-colour printing capabilities. The successful candidate will be responsible for setting up, operating, and monitoring die cutting equipment while ensuring product quality, production efficiency, and safety standards are consistently met. This is a lead machinist role suited for someone who can take ownership of the machine, troubleshoot production issues, and support the team on the floor.
Key Responsibilities
Set up, operate, and monitor rotary die cutting equipment, including 2-colour printing functions. Review job tickets, work orders, die layouts, print requirements, and production specifications. Install and adjust cutting dies, printing plates, ink, tooling, and related machine components. Ensure accurate cutting, creasing, printing, stripping, and stacking of corrugated products. Monitor machine performance throughout production runs and make adjustments as required. Perform regular quality checks to ensure finished products meet customer specifications. Troubleshoot machine issues, registration concerns, print defects, die cutting problems, and material flow issues. Lead by example and support machine crew members during setup, production, changeovers, and cleanup.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work area. Follow all company safety procedures, production standards, and lockout/tagout requirements. Communicate downtime, quality concerns, material issues, or maintenance needs to supervisors. Assist with basic machine maintenance and preventative maintenance activities.
Qualifications
2–5 years of experience operating die cutting equipment in a corrugated packaging or related manufacturing environment. Experience with RDC, Ward, McKinley, or similar rotary die cutting equipment is a strong asset. Experience with 2-colour printing is considered an asset. Strong mechanical aptitude and ability to troubleshoot machine issues. Ability to read work orders, production specifications, measurements, and layouts accurately. Previous lead hand, senior operator, or lead machinist experience is an asset. Strong attention to detail, quality, production efficiency, and safety. Ability to work independently and within a team environment. Comfortable working either day shift or afternoon shift.
